Transaction 17af64248786d23a340a5592529a22ba36710bada15db60d61ae60ff7d7f26f5
1 Input
1 Output
-
17af64248786d23a340a5592529a22ba36710bada15db60d61ae60ff7d7f26f5:0
- value
- 95260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b3d9cdfdd072fd406b2916615e82a28a5856aa8 OP_EQUAL
- address
- 3FqrUD66oFXtJgJ43CwEfLj4ZBbJTY2xi6